package main
import (
"context"
"time"
"cloud.google.com/go/bigquery"
"github.com/rs/zerolog/log"
)
// BigQueryClient is the interface for connecting to bigquery
type BigQueryClient interface {
CheckIfDatasetExists(dataset string) bool
CheckIfTableExists(dataset, table string) bool
CreateTable(dataset, table string, typeForSchema interface{}, partitionField string, waitReady bool) error
UpdateTableSchema(dataset, table string, typeForSchema interface{}) error
DeleteTable(dataset, table string) error
InsertMeasurement(dataset, table string, measurement BigQueryMeasurement) error
}
type bigQueryClientImpl struct {
client *bigquery.Client
enable bool
}
// NewBigQueryClient returns new BigQueryClient
func NewBigQueryClient(projectID string, enable bool) (BigQueryClient, error) {
ctx := context.Background()
bigqueryClient, err := bigquery.NewClient(ctx, projectID)
if err != nil {
return nil, err
}
return &bigQueryClientImpl{
client: bigqueryClient,
enable: enable,
}, nil
}
func (bqc *bigQueryClientImpl) CheckIfDatasetExists(dataset string) bool {
if !bqc.enable {
return false
}
ds := bqc.client.Dataset(dataset)
md, err := ds.Metadata(context.Background())
log.Error().Err(err).Msgf("Error retrieving metadata for dataset %v", dataset)
return md != nil
}
func (bqc *bigQueryClientImpl) CheckIfTableExists(dataset, table string) bool {
if !bqc.enable {
return false
}
tbl := bqc.client.Dataset(dataset).Table(table)
md, _ := tbl.Metadata(context.Background())
// log.Error().Err(err).Msgf("Error retrieving metadata for table %v", table)
return md != nil
}
func (bqc *bigQueryClientImpl) CreateTable(dataset, table string, typeForSchema interface{}, partitionField string, waitReady bool) error {
if !bqc.enable {
return nil
}
tbl := bqc.client.Dataset(dataset).Table(table)
// infer the schema of the type
schema, err := bigquery.InferSchema(typeForSchema)
if err != nil {
return err
}
tableMetadata := &bigquery.TableMetadata{
Schema: schema,
}
// if partitionField is set use it for time partitioning
if partitionField != "" {
tableMetadata.TimePartitioning = &bigquery.TimePartitioning{
Field: partitionField,
}
}
// create the table
err = tbl.Create(context.Background(), tableMetadata)
if err != nil {
return err
}
if waitReady {
for {
if bqc.CheckIfTableExists(dataset, table) {
break
}
time.Sleep(time.Second)
}
}
return nil
}
func (bqc *bigQueryClientImpl) UpdateTableSchema(dataset, table string, typeForSchema interface{}) error {
if !bqc.enable {
return nil
}
tbl := bqc.client.Dataset(dataset).Table(table)
// infer the schema of the type
schema, err := bigquery.InferSchema(typeForSchema)
if err != nil {
return err
}
meta, err := tbl.Metadata(context.Background())
if err != nil {
return err
}
update := bigquery.TableMetadataToUpdate{
Schema: schema,
}
if _, err := tbl.Update(context.Background(), update, meta.ETag); err != nil {
return err
}
return nil
}
func (bqc *bigQueryClientImpl) DeleteTable(dataset, table string) error {
if !bqc.enable {
return nil
}
tbl := bqc.client.Dataset(dataset).Table(table)
// delete the table
err := tbl.Delete(context.Background())
if err != nil {
return err
}
return nil
}
func (bqc *bigQueryClientImpl) InsertMeasurement(dataset, table string, measurement BigQueryMeasurement) error {
if !bqc.enable {
return nil
}
tbl := bqc.client.Dataset(dataset).Table(table)
u := tbl.Uploader()
if err := u.Put(context.Background(), measurement); err != nil {
return err
}
return nil
}
